It does look at lot like LiteSwitch, doesn't it?

While there hasn't been an official update for Panther, the current version of LiteSwitch works fine, completely over-riding OS X's built-in "homage", let's call it. (LiteSwitch Lite?)

A lot of the key commands mentioned in this hint apply to LiteSwitch, too, although to back-cycle in LS, all you have to hit is cmd+shift, not cmd+shift+tab. And don't forget f,f to Force Quit and f,r to Force Relaunch.
